12 2019 档案

摘要:1. 两数之和 总结 可以看到,无论是2、3or4,都是固定除了双指针之外的元素,再用双指针去找剩下的元素,代码几乎没有改变,切记要记得剪枝。 阅读全文
posted @ 2019-12-22 15:23 但是我拒绝 阅读(488) 评论(1) 推荐(1) 编辑
摘要:700. 二叉搜索树中的搜索 树 给定二叉搜索树(BST)的根节点和一个值。 你需要在BST中找到节点值等于给定值的节点。 返回以该节点为根的子树。 如果节点不存在,则返回 NULL。 思路: 二叉搜索树的特点为左比根小,右比根大。那么目标结点就有三种可能: 1. 和根一样大,那么直接返回根即可。 阅读全文
posted @ 2019-12-22 09:31 但是我拒绝 阅读(285) 评论(1) 推荐(0) 编辑
摘要:🎃本次部分没有带题目,因为链表系列的题目有的非常直观,从名字中就能知道到底需要做什么。 21. 合并两个有序链表 203. 移除链表元素 206. 反转链表 24. 两两交换链表中的节点 19. 删除链表的倒数第N个节点 876. 链表的中间结点 阅读全文
posted @ 2019-12-21 08:00 但是我拒绝 阅读(186) 评论(1) 推荐(0) 编辑
摘要:756. 金字塔转换矩阵 491. 递增子序列 721. 账户合并 988. 从叶结点开始的最小字符串 阅读全文
posted @ 2019-12-21 07:44 但是我拒绝 阅读(309) 评论(1) 推荐(0) 编辑
摘要:~~leetcode真的是一个学习阅读理解的好地方~~ 860. 柠檬水找零 1046. 最后一块石头的重量 1217. 玩筹码 1221. 分割平衡字符串 阅读全文
posted @ 2019-12-20 11:21 但是我拒绝 阅读(366) 评论(1) 推荐(1) 编辑
摘要:解决方案: 1. 首先查看数据库的版本号,删除旧的jar包,将mysql connector java.jar更换成对应版本号 2. 同时在连接数据库的url后加上 阅读全文
posted @ 2019-12-16 12:43 但是我拒绝 阅读(3605) 评论(0) 推荐(0) 编辑
摘要:本文基于leetcode的200.岛屿数量(题目👇)为基础进行说明 DFS实现 阅读全文
posted @ 2019-12-15 14:38 但是我拒绝 阅读(1103) 评论(1) 推荐(1) 编辑
摘要:本文以Leetcode中695、岛屿的最大面积题目为基础进行展开(题目👇)。 DFS实现 阅读全文
posted @ 2019-12-11 14:40 但是我拒绝 阅读(486) 评论(1) 推荐(0) 编辑
摘要:这次接触到记忆化DFS,不过还需要多加练习 113. 路径总和 II (根到叶子结点相关信息记录) 114. 二叉树展开为链表 116. 填充每个节点的下一个右侧节点指针 / 117. 填充每个节点的下一个右侧节点指针 II (116和117同样的代码都可以通过。) 1020. 飞地的数量 576. 阅读全文
posted @ 2019-12-09 15:07 但是我拒绝 阅读(326) 评论(1) 推荐(0) 编辑
摘要:经常会遇到字典样式字符串的处理,这里做一下记录。 load load针对的是文件,即将文件内的json内容转换为dict loads loads是直接将字符串对象转换为了dict eval (用eval有时候可能会出现问题,推荐使用loads) 阅读全文
posted @ 2019-12-04 21:14 但是我拒绝 阅读(1257) 评论(1) 推荐(0) 编辑
摘要:前言 想要批量将ip地址转换为省份城市、国家或是经纬度?百度上的批量查找每次的容量太小满足不了要求?第三方库神器 帮你解决所有烦恼。 准备工作 1. 首先安装一下geoip2库, 2. 前往官网下载一下数据包,下载地址https://dev.maxmind.com/geoip/geoip2/geol 阅读全文
posted @ 2019-12-03 20:55 但是我拒绝 阅读(2288) 评论(1) 推荐(0) 编辑